Discover more about Parque Fluvial Vallarta

Parque Fluvial Vallarta is a beautiful urban park located in the heart of Puerto Vallarta, Mexico. This serene oasis is designed to provide a peaceful retreat from the bustling city life, making it an ideal destination for tourists looking to connect with nature. The park features a diverse landscape filled with lush greenery, vibrant flowers, and winding paths that invite leisurely strolls. Whether you're an avid jogger or someone who enjoys a quiet walk, the paved trails cater to all fitness levels and create a perfect environment for outdoor activities. In addition to its stunning scenery, Parque Fluvial Vallarta is home to a variety of bird species and other wildlife, making it an excellent spot for birdwatching enthusiasts. As you wander through the park, you might catch sight of colorful birds flitting through the trees or hear their melodious songs echoing through the area. The park's natural beauty is complemented by thoughtfully placed benches and shaded areas, perfect for resting and soaking in the tranquil atmosphere.     Getting There

    Bus

    From the Zona Romántica area, walk to the nearest bus stop on Avenida Insurgentes. Wait for a bus heading towards the Fluvial Vallarta neighborhood. Look for buses marked 'Fluvial Vallarta' or 'Mismaloya.' The fare is approximately 10 pesos. After about 20 minutes, get off at the stop near Río Nilo street. From there, walk 5 minutes east along Río Nilo to reach Parque Fluvial Vallarta at Río Nilo 152.

    Taxi or Rideshare

    If you prefer a more direct route, you can take a taxi or use a rideshare app like Uber. Request your ride to Parque Fluvial Vallarta, and provide the address: Río Nilo 152, Fluvial Vallarta. The trip should take around 10-15 minutes depending on traffic, and the fare will vary but expect to pay around 80-120 pesos.

    Walking

    If you are staying in the Fluvial Vallarta area or nearby, you can walk to Parque Fluvial Vallarta. Locate Río Nilo street and walk towards the address Río Nilo 152. The park is well-signposted, and you should arrive in about 10-20 minutes depending on your starting point.
